It appears that all was not well during the filming of the last two seasons of Top Gear for Richard Hammond.
Eighteen months after the high-speed crash which almost killed him, Top Gear presenter Richard Hammond has revealed that he still suffers from emotional problems and memory loss.

“It’s been a bloody long journey and it’s still going. It’s when I consider how far I’ve come since I was in hospital that I realise there was a lot more to fix than I thought. The swelling has gone down, my brain is as mended as it’s likely to be. Now it seems to be more a case of rewiring itself. That’s assuming I’m sitting here talking to you and I’m not about to wake up in hospital, in some sort of Life on Mars moment . . . Now that was a difficult TV series to watch.”
